Additional Notes P 1992. By 11/06: privately owned and restoration well underway, including major rebuild to toilet end. New corridor connector fitted to replace damaged one. 2018: passed into GWSR ownership. 09/19: no date available for further work at present. 03/22: sold by Gloucestershire Warwickshire Steam Railway to Bodmin and Wenford Railway.
